摘要
Crack propagation behaviour in sintered alumina has been observed by in situ straining experiments in a transmission electron microscope at 800-degrees-C. Dislocations were generated at the crack tips, and the strain contour line around the crack tips was found to oscillate periodically during crack propagation. Crack deflection through grain boundaries occurred after a fan-shaped strain appeared when the crack intersected the grain boundary.
